Built for marine applications, this heavy-duty 360-degree actuation valve regulates seawater flow in ship cooling systems and desalination plants. The biofouling-resistant epoxy coating prevents barnacle growth, while the bronze body resists saltwater corrosion. The ergonomic handwheel allows full-rotation adjustments even in high-vibration environments, ensuring reliable performance in rough seas. Ideal for ship engineers and offshore platforms, it includes a failsafe lock to prevent accidental closure during operation.
Biofouling-resistant coating extends service life in seawater.
360-degree rotational handwheel for precise flow control.
Bronze construction resists pitting and galvanic corrosion.
Failsafe lock prevents unintended valve closure.
Compatible with seawater, brine, and cooling fluids.
Installed in cargo ship engine rooms to manage seawater intake for cooling systems.
Sand-cast bronze components polished to NACE standards. Pressure-tested to 300 PSI.
Coated in marine-grade grease, packed in waterproof wooden crates.
